Ubuntu,这一广受欢迎的开源Linux发行版,因其稳定性、丰富的社区支持和强大的功能,成为许多用户的首选操作系统之一
然而,在VMware中安装Ubuntu后,有时会遇到键盘失灵的问题,这无疑给使用者带来了极大的不便
本文将深入探讨这一现象的原因,并提供一系列经过验证的解决方案,帮助用户彻底告别这一烦恼
一、问题概述:键盘失灵的普遍性与影响 在使用VMware Workstation或VMware Fusion(针对Mac用户)虚拟化环境中安装Ubuntu后,部分用户报告键盘无法正常工作
这一问题可能表现为: - 部分或全部键盘按键无响应
- 特定功能键(如Ctrl、Alt、Fn等)失灵
- 键盘输入延迟或错误字符输出
键盘作为人机交互的核心工具,一旦失灵,将直接影响到系统的操作效率和使用体验
对于依赖键盘进行编程、文档编辑或系统管理的用户而言,这一问题尤为棘手
二、原因分析:多维度探讨 键盘失灵问题在VMware与Ubuntu的结合使用中并非孤立事件,其背后可能隐藏着多重因素: 1.VMware Tools未正确安装或配置:VMware Tools是一套增强虚拟机和宿主机之间交互的软件包,其中包括了对键盘、鼠标等输入设备的优化
如果VMware Tools未安装或配置不当,可能会导致键盘无法正常工作
2.Ubuntu系统配置问题:Ubuntu系统的某些设置可能与VMware的虚拟化环境不兼容,尤其是关于键盘布局、输入法等设置
3.虚拟机硬件配置错误:在创建虚拟机时,如果未正确配置USB控制器、键盘设备等硬件参数,也可能导致键盘失灵
4.宿主机操作系统干扰:宿主机(如Windows或macOS)的特定设置或软件可能与VMware中的Ubuntu虚拟机产生冲突,影响键盘输入
5.版本兼容性问题:不同版本的VMware Workstation/Fusion与Ubuntu之间可能存在兼容性问题,特别是在新版本发布初期
三、解决方案:从基础到高级 针对上述问题,以下是一系列经过实践检验的解决方案,旨在帮助用户恢复键盘功能: 1. 安装并更新VMware Tools - 步骤:启动Ubuntu虚拟机,从VMware菜单中选择“虚拟机”->“安装VMware Tools”
随后,在Ubuntu中挂载VMware Tools ISO镜像,按照提示完成安装
安装完成后,重启虚拟机
- 注意:确保使用的是与VMware版本相匹配的VMware Tools版本
2. 检查并调整Ubuntu键盘设置 - 步骤:进入Ubuntu设置->“区域与语言”,检查键盘布局是否正确
如有需要,可添加或更改键盘布局
同时,检查输入法设置,确保没有启用与当前需求不符的输入法
3. 配置虚拟机硬件设置 - 步骤:关闭虚拟机,在VMware Workstation/Fusion中打开虚拟机设置
检查USB控制器设置,确保已启用并选择合适的USB版本(如USB 3.0或USB 2.0)
同时,检查键盘设备设置,确保已正确识别并配置
4. 禁用宿主机键盘快捷键冲突 - 步骤:在某些情况下,宿主机的快捷键可能与虚拟机内的Ubuntu产生冲突
尝试禁用宿主机上可能与键盘输入相关的快捷键,或在VMware中配置快捷键偏好设置,避免冲突
5. 使用虚拟键盘作为临时解决方案 - 步骤:如果上述方法均未能解决问题,可以尝试在Ubuntu中启用屏幕键盘作为临时替代方案
这可以通过Ubuntu的设置菜单或安装第三方屏幕键盘软件实现
6. 升级或降级VMware与Ubuntu版本 - 步骤:如果怀疑是版本兼容性问题导致,考虑将VMware Workstation/Fusion升级至最新版本,或尝试降级至一个与当前Ubuntu版本更兼容的旧版本
同时,检查Ubuntu的更新,确保系统是最新的稳定版本
7. 查看日志文件与社区支持 - 步骤:如果问题依旧存在,查看Ubuntu的日志文件(如`/var/log/syslog`)或VMware的日志,寻找可能的错误信息
此外,访问VMware和Ubuntu的官方论坛、社区,搜索相似问题的解决方案或寻求帮助
四、总结与展望 键盘失灵虽是一个看似简单却影响深远的问题,但通过系统性的排查和针对性的解决方案,大多数用户都能成功恢复键盘功能
VMware与Ubuntu作为虚拟化技术和开源操作系统的佼佼者,其间的兼容性问题往往随着软件版本的更新而逐渐减少
未来,随着技术的不断进步和社区支持的不断加强,我们有理由相信,这类问题将得到更加高效和智能的解决
对于用户而言,保持系统更新、合理配置虚拟机、积极利用社区资源,是预防和解决此类问题的关键
同时,在遇到问题时保持耐心和细心,逐一排查可能的原因,往往能更快地找到问题的根源,从而恢复系统的正常运行
总之,虽然VMware中安装Ubuntu后键盘失灵的问题可能会给用户带来困扰,但通过科学的方法和有效的解决方案,我们完全有能力克服这一挑战,享受虚拟化技术带来的便利与高效